Abstract

The invention belongs to the technical field of organic fertilizers, and particularly relates to a high-calcium-magnesium-silicon strong-buffering organic fertilizer and a preparation method thereof. The high-calcium-magnesium-silicon strong-buffering organic fertilizer is prepared from the following raw materials in parts by weight: 70-80 parts of a filter mud organic fertilizer, 10-15 parts of dolomite powder, 9-14 parts of a calcium magnesium phosphate fertilizer, 0.5-1.0 part of sodium metasilicate and 0.5-2.0 parts of a cross-linking agent. Compared with a traditional calcareous soil conditioner, the soil conditioner disclosed by the invention has the dual functions of fertilizing soil and inhibiting acidification for a long time of a traditional organic fertilizer while rapidly reducing the acidity of the soil; compared with a common organic fertilizer, on the premise that the industrial standard is met, the buffer capacity of unit fertilizer to acid is greatly improved, and the dual effects of efficient acid treatment and soil fertility improvement are achieved through the synergistic effect of rapid neutralization of active acid and long-acting inhibition of potential acid and organic matter improvement. After granulation process treatment, the problem of dust raising during application of traditional lime powder is solved, mechanical operation and large-scale transportation are facilitated, and the practical bottleneck of popularization and application of organic fertilizer is effectively broken through.
